DEFORM V14.0.2 Manual

INTRST

(Inter-object data)  
Update History: v11.1 – FuncTyp 3 has been introduced. Last updated on : 14-05-2016

INTRST Object1, Object2, FuncTyp, ElcRst/Ndata[Ndata2]

Time/Prs(1), ElcRst(1)

:

Time/Prs(Ndata), ElcRst(Ndata)


OPERAND DESCRIPTION DEFAULT
Object1 Object number of first object None
Object2 Object number of second object None
FuncTyp Function type = 0 Constant electric resistance = 1 Electric resistance is a function of temperature = 2 Electric resistance is a function of pressure = 3 electric resistance is a function of temperature and pressure (new in v11.1) None
ElcRst Electric resistance when FrictType = 0 0.0
Ndata Number of Time/Prs electric resistance data pairs None
Ndata2 Number of Prs electric resistance data pairs None
Time/Prs(i) Time (Ftype = 1), or pressure (Ftype = 2) of ith data pair None
ElcRst(i) Electric resistance of ith data pair None

DEFINITION

INTRST specifies the electric resistance at the interface between two objects.

REMARKS

Applicable object types: Rigid, Elastic, Plastic, Elastoplastic and Porous.
